Full Job Posting

What you’ll do

Provide regulatory advice and guidance to our UK business focusing on the direct to consumer (D2C) business ‘Consumer Solutions’, Open Banking, Complaints, Consumer Product Development, Marketing, Sales and Transformation programmes.

Support the development of the UK mandatory compliance induction and annual training.

Provide input into the Compliance Risk Universe and Monitoring Plan, taking a lead on Compliance Monitoring reviews to identify areas of risk and support the business in finding effective solutions.

Raise conduct and compliance risk awareness.

Support the Compliance Director and wider leadership team with queries or issues raised by the FCA, ICO or other relevant regulators.

What experience you need

Strong compliance experience (or equivalent) working in an FCA regulated environment.

Good knowledge of Financial Services - such as Consumer Credit, Banking & Insurance.

Strong understanding of FCA requirements including Consumer Duty, PRIN, COND, DISP, CONC and SYSC; the ability to apply these pragmatically and in the context of business risk

Strong knowledge and understanding of conduct and/or regulatory risk, particularly with regards to controls/MI/governance, business strategy, product lifecycle, policies and defining risk metrics/appetites

An ability to dig below the surface to understand context, materiality and root causes.

Experience in assurance and controls testing, identifying areas of risk and finding pragmatic solutions.

Good track record in understanding business models, associated risks and partnering senior business stakeholders.

Good experience of digging below the surface and understanding the context and materiality of risks

There is an expectation of more proactive constructive challenge and independent stakeholder management for the P3 role, whereas the P2 will focus more on supporting the operational implementation and monitoring tasks.

What could set you apart

Credit reference agency knowledge

Debt services knowledge

Open banking knowledge
